Dear parents, guardians and pupils,

I hope that you are all keeping safe and well. Last Thursday, the 12th of March, the boys were sent home from school with work to complete up until the 29th of March. Below is the list of work which I assigned to be completed by the 29th of March. When the full list is completed, it can be sent to me by parents on the school email- mrbrennanmqa2@gmail.com to be graded ​OR I can collect and grade it in person when school returns. If school does not re-open on March the 29th, I will update the list of work each week and I would ask you to check the updated list.

I understand that this is a stressful and unclear time for us all and I do not wish to put added pressure on you or your sons however, it is important to maintain some degree of structure to help us to best get through this uncertain time ahead. The boys have worked so hard so far this year and I ask them to complete at least the three assigned pieces of work below to best ensure that this is maintained.

The assigned work for the week 23rd-27th March includes:
​
- Spellbound, week 25 (all activities- A to H)
- Master Your Maths, week 25 (Monday-Thursday)
- Book review- on any book with at least 100 pages (or there abouts). They were given a template to complete however if they misplaced the template or would rather not use it, they can write a copybook page to page and a half review on what the book was about, the characters, their likes, dislikes etc.


Here is also a list of activities which the pupils can do to help pass the time if they wish:

Phone an elderly relative for a chat.
Tidy your room.
Learn to tie shoe laces.
Help out by offering to a household chore everyday.
Drawing (there are great step-by-step tutorials on YouTube)
Participate in a skill challenge everyday. For example-
  • How many times can you fist pass and catch a ball off a wall in one minute?
  • How many keepie-uppies can you do with a ball?
  • How many burpees in 30 seconds?
 You can make up your own for you and your friends.
